Lot 283: NAVAJO HORSE RACE BY FRANK TENNEY JOHNSON (CALIFORNIA, 1874-1939).

NAVAJO HORSE RACE BY FRANK TENNEY JOHNSON (CALIFORNIA, 1874-1939). Oil on canvas, signed and dated 1927 in lower left, titled on the stretcher. Young men racing horses through the desert. Minor craquelure. 26 1/2"h. 32 1/2"w. Descended in the family [...more]

 

Lot 284: PORTRAIT OF A YOUNG CHILD (AMERICAN SCHOOL, 1ST HALF-19TH CENTURY).

PORTRAIT OF A YOUNG CHILD (AMERICAN SCHOOL, 1ST HALF-19TH CENTURY). Oil on single poplar board, unsigned. Seated child dressed in white holding a book. Some imperfections. 25 3/4"h. 21 1/2"w., in a grain decorated frame, 30 1/2"h. 26 1/2"w.

 

Lot 285: FARM SCENE (AMERICAN SCHOOL, 2ND HALF-19TH CENTURY).

FARM SCENE (AMERICAN SCHOOL, 2ND HALF-19TH CENTURY). Oil on canvas, unsigned. Rustic scene of a barnyard with well and a mill in the background. Imperfections. 22"h. 36"w., in a gold-painted frame, 29"h. 43"w.

 

Lot 286: SHERATON SUGAR CHEST.

SHERATON SUGAR CHEST. Kentucky or Tennessee, 1820-1840, cherry, white pine, and yellow pine. Single drawer and resting on turned legs. Imperfections. 33 1/4"h. 35 1/2"w. 16 3/4"d.

 

Lot 287: LADDERBACK ARMCHAIR.

LADDERBACK ARMCHAIR. American, early 19th century, maple. Sausage turnings, scrolled arms and a stretcher base, old paper rush seat. Worn red is old if not original. . 14" seat, 39 1/2"h.
